PATEK PHILIPPE REF 5040 YELLOW GOLD Patek Philippe, Genève, movement No. 776581, Ref. 5040J. Made circa 1994. Very fine and rare, tonneau-shaped, self-winding, 18K yellow gold wristwatch with perpetual calendar, moon phases, 24-hour indication and 18K yellow gold Patek Philippe deployant clasp.

Two-body, solid, polished and brushed, concave lugs, transparent snap-on case back. Satiné silver with applied yellow gold Breguet numerals, subsidiary guilloché dials for the days of the month, days of the week, the months, the leap year, the 24 hours, aperture for the moon phases. Yellow gold Breguet hands. Cal. 240 Q, stamped with the Seal of Geneva quality mark, rhodium-plated, fausses cotes decoration, 27 jewels, straight-line lever escapement, Gyromax balance adjusted to heat, cold, isochronism and 5 positions, shock absorber, free-sprung self-compensating flat balance spring, 22K gold micro-rotor.
